About the time Henry Plumber was conning the citizens of Bannack and Virginia City, Montana, Stephen Renfroe had his own sheriff/outlaw scam going in Livingston, Alabama. Plummer while in his sheriff?s office ran a gang of holdup men and thieves and Renfroe while supposedly enforcing the law as sheriff had his own criminal activities going. In the 1860s Renfroe as a young man won the praise and admiration of the populace of Sumter County Alabama by helping to get rid of carpetbaggers, scalawags and Republicans. The grateful people of the county rewarded Renfroe by making him the sheriff. In this post, as was Henry Plummer (many miles to the West), he was able to engage in criminal activities with not too much danger of being nabbed by the law which was the Sheriff of Sumter County . which was himself, Stephen Renfroe. But over the subsequent years he was caught and placed in jail a number of times. However, Renfroe was not only a skilled sheriff and an able criminal he was also a versatile escape artist. And escape he did, many times. For years the legendary Stephen Renfroe has occupied a place in Alabama history and folklore (and to a lesser degree, Southern history). With this thoroughly documented study, the enigmatic lawman has been placed in historical cal perspective. The author traces his career from early manhood through the Civil War, and the violent period of Reconstruction in Alabama?s ?Black Belt?. His final years of sheriff of Sumter County and as notorious outlaw are closely detailed. Renfroe?s brilliant escapes as an outlaw made him as famous as his crimes. Signed by Author(s).
